Last November Georgi vodka started running an ad campaign on city busses that just showed a woman’s ass in a bikini with sand on it. Viacom, the company in charge of bus billboard program for the MTA, took the ads down after receiving complaints that the ad was too racy.
Well, the ads are back, this time on yellow cabs. And surpisingly some uptight do-gooder’s aren’t very happy about it.
Kanta Singh, a 42-year-old Empire State Building supervisor from Queens, said the ads are not appropriate for kids.
“I wouldn’t want my children looking at these ads,” said Singh. “This is why I’m scared to take my kids into the city because I fear that they may see images like these on taxis.”
